Get started56 Coombe Drive is a three-bedroom detached house in Addlestone (KT15 1DD). It has a recorded floor area of 119 m² (around 1281 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(May 2016) shows a D (score 67),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 79). The latest certificate is from May 2016,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 5.7%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£618,000 is 38.9% above the 2016 sale price. 2 planning records sit against the property, 1 approved, 1 refused. Past consents include an extension and a porch,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 119 m² it's 22.7% larger than the typical home in the postcode (97 m² median across 11 EPCs).
